2. Have never heard about electronic signatures. Are they similar comparing to physical ones?
Yes, and it's completely legal. After ESIGN Act concluded in 2000, an e-signature is considered legal, just like physical one is. You are able to fill out a word file and sign it, and it will be as legally binding as its physical equivalent.
